Kia Cee'd 2016 - a Korean hatchback for Europe.
The compact hatchback adds three new engine options and features upgraded interior and exterior design for a more attractive look.
Kia has officially introduced the updated 2016 Cee'd with a host of new features.
The exterior changes are minimal, featuring new 16 and 17-inch alloy wheels, a wider and more angular front bumper. The fog lights have chrome surrounds, while the tiger-nose grille also uses chrome trim and has an oval-shaped rounded edge.

The rear of the car features a new rear bumper and diamond-shaped LED taillights; however, the placement of the daytime running lights is somewhat outdated. This could be a design detail that suits the tastes of European customers, a market with different preferences from the rest of the world.
Kia states that noise, vibration, and harshness inside the cabin are significantly reduced thanks to sound-dampening materials, while the diesel versions also utilize sound-absorbing materials in the engine, crankcase, and oil filter. The cabin is further enhanced with chrome accents on the instrument cluster and air vents.
More importantly, the Cee'd engine lineup will feature three new variants. First is a 1-liter, 3-cylinder ecoTurbo producing either 99 hp or 118 hp, both delivering a peak torque of 172 Nm. The petrol options remain the 1.6-liter GDI with 126 hp and the 1.4-liter MPI with 99 hp.
In terms of diesel engines, the 2016 Cee'd continues to use the CRDi type, producing 108 horsepower, while higher-powered versions offer 126 horsepower and 265 Nm of torque, and 134 horsepower and 285 Nm of torque. Kia has added a 7-speed dual-clutch transmission specifically for the top-of-the-line diesel version. Other versions use a 6-speed manual transmission, while the 1.6-liter GDI uses a 6-speed dual-clutch transmission.
The top-of-the-line Cee'd GT features upgraded exterior and interior elements, including a flat-bottomed steering wheel and aluminum start/stop buttons. The hatchback also comes equipped with electronic audio controls that change the exhaust sound after switching to GT Mode, activated by a button on the steering wheel.
The car's engine is a 1.6-liter four-cylinder gasoline engine producing 201 horsepower and 265 Nm of torque, with a new turbocharger increasing compressed air to boost engine response at low RPMs. The car accelerates from 0-100 km/h in 7.6 seconds.
The 2016 Kia Cee'd will go on sale in Europe next month; this is also the small hatchback that the South Korean automaker is using exclusively for this market.
